Watch Newcastle lift Diriyah Cup as Toon owners greet players after 5-0 win in Saudi – Video

Newcastle United were awarded with the Diriyah Cup at the Prince Faisal bin Fahd Stadium on Thursday night after a commanding display from Eddie Howe’s Mags saw us put FIVE past Al-Hilal.

A first-half brace from Joelinton was followed by two second half goals from Miguel Almiron, with U21 talent Dylan Stephenson rounding off the scoring to seal a convincing win for the Toon.

After the game, chairman Yasir Al-Rumayyan joined co-owners Amanda Staveley, Mehrdad Ghodoussi and Jamie Reuben on the field as an on-field platform was erected to present the players with the cup.
